In Short – An array of drink specials ($5 margs, $1 beers) and a menu built for the masses keeps this brightly-colored Highlands cantina slammed on a nightly basis. The affordable style and primo location attract a diverse crowd: stalwart scenesters starting their night with a light nosh; upwardly mobile 20- and 30-somethings sipping margaritas after work; and Emory seniors who nurse pitchers of beer and flirt with the upbeat, if slightly scatterbrained, servers. Editor's Tips
- Where to Sit:
- The breezy terrace in the back is in high demand. Call early and make reservations. If you're not opposed to eating indoors, you can typically snag a table on weekday nights without a reservation.
- What to Drink:
- Margaritas, with their Key lime base, are sweet. For a stronger, less-syrupy version, try the Silver or Cabo Wabo variations.
- Save Money:
- On Monday nights, enjoy all-you-can-eat tapas for $10. On Sundays, kick back with Dos Equis for a buck.
